How Sewer Backup Water Removal Works in Falcon Heights, MN
A proper sewer backup water removal process is crucial to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ure a thorough and efficient restoration. We’ll start by…
Assessing the Damage
Our team will conduct a thorough inspection of the affected area to identify the source of the sewer backup and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and water damage.
Extracting Water and Debris
We’ll use advanced equipment, such as truck-mounted pumps and water extractors, to remove standing water and debris from your property. This step is critical to preventing further damage and mold growth.
Documenting the Process
Our team will document the entire restoration process, including photos and videos, to provide evidence for your insurance company. This detailed report will help help with a smooth claims process.
Conducting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, preventing further moisture damage and m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get you back to normal as soon as possible.
Restoring Your Property
Once the water and debris have been removed, our team will restore your property to its original condition. We’ll work with you to select the best materials and finishes to match your home or business.

Warning Signs You Need Sewer Backup Water Removal in the Area
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Catching them early can save you money and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show sewer backup water damage. If you notice persistent smells,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Visible water st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of a more significant issue.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Warped or discolored flooring can show water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to investigate the source and take action quickly.
Backed-Up Drains or Toilets
Backed-up drains or toilets can be a sign of a sewer backup. Don’t wait until it’s too late; call our team for immediate help.
Visible Water Damage in Your Home or Business
Visible water damage can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ice water damage,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Sewer Backup Water Removal Cost in Falcon Heights, MN
The cost of sewer backup water removal in Falcon Heights, MN,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and should not be considered a guarantee of the actual cost.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ue. |
| Water Extraction and Debris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of debris.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the extent of the moisture damage. |
| Property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the restoration. |
| Documentation and Claims Support |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the claims process and the amount of documentation required. |
